This week, the three of us:

* noted that `use VERSION` restrictions have had mostly positive responses
* thought that `Data::Printer` can't go in core as-is, but there's a use case for a debugging helper, some of which might be hidden in D:P's core
* discussed adding a `builtin::numify` function (and the corresponding OP in core)
* quickly reviewed the PPCs currently being implemented:
* we should ping the implementors of PPC0014 (English names) and PPC0021 (optional chaining)
* PPC0022 (meta) has an implementation on CPAN
* PPC0019 (qt strings) implementation is in progress, but unlikely to be done by 5.40
* PPC0013 (overload in join) is currently stalled
